IN LOVING MEMORY OF
Cecil
Dyar
January 22, 1937 – May 20, 2025
Cecil Dyar, 88, of Anderson, South Carolina, passed away peacefully on May 20, 2025.
Born in Townville, SC, on January 22, 1937, he was the son of the late Denver Harrison and Mandy Dyar. His siblings include Sybil Mullinax, Charles Dyar (Carol), and Donald Dyar (Margaret).
Cecil graduated from Boy's High in 1955. He shared forty-eight beautiful years of marriage with his devoted wife, Jane Hutchins Dyar, who stood by his side through life's many seasons.
Cecil was the proud father to Diane Fulton (Jim), Rev. Dale Dyar (Teresa), Phyllis Bolt (Jack), Tim Bolt (Tammy), David Dyar (Rachel), Jim Bolt, and Rev. Paul Dyar (Kim). His legacy lives on through his cherished grandchildren: Alicia Barrett, Josh Barrett (Stephanie), Jarrod Dyar (Taylor), Jordan Dyar (Ammie), Haley Sapp (Andrew), Kevin Bolt (Gina), Kayla Ammons (Mark), Brandon Bolt (Mindy), Samantha Clardy (Logan), Amanda Moss (Jim), Jennifer Burdette (Jeff), Kasey Bolt (Patrick), Matthew Bolt (Haley), Grace Bolt, Anna Beard (Joey), Wesley Dyar (Makinley), Eli Dyar, and Jaden Dyar. He was also blessed with numerous great grandchildren who brought him immense joy.
Cecil was deeply committed to his faith and community. He was a faithful member of River of Life Church of God, served on the COG State layman's board, and his life was a testament to his unwavering belief in God's grace. He served with Crime Stoppers and the Fraternal Order of Police. He was a former president of Woodman of the World, former president of Anderson Sertoma, and a member of the Anderson Senior Follies Alumni. As the owner of Anderson Steel and Pallet Company for thirty-three years, Cecil exemplified hard work and dedication.
Cecil's life was marked by love for his family, devotion to his faith, and service to others. May his memory bring comfort and peace to all who knew him.
